Steroid Free Nasal Sprays Market Segmentation Analysis:
By Product:
The antihistamine segment dominates the steroid-free nasal sprays market, accounting for over 35% of the revenue share in 2024. Its leadership stems from strong demand in allergic rhinitis and seasonal allergy management. Non-sedative formulations and rapid symptom relief drive preference among both pediatric and adult patients. Decongestant sprays follow, supported by their wide use in cold-related nasal blockage. Anticholinergic and cromolyn sodium sprays cater to niche cases like vasomotor rhinitis and mast cell-mediated disorders. The “others” category includes herbal and homeopathic options gaining attention for clean-label preferences in select markets.

By Formulation:
Aqueous formulations lead the market with more than 40% share due to their superior patient compliance and safety. These sprays are widely prescribed for their ease of use, quick action, and low irritation profile. Suspension-based sprays follow closely, especially in combination therapies where stability and controlled release are critical. Nonaqueous-based solutions and hydroalcoholic types are used in specific clinical settings, offering extended shelf life and better solubility for select compounds. Emulsions and dry powder/micro-particle sprays are emerging, targeting chronic users seeking preservative-free and portable alternatives.

Key Growth Drivers
Rising Preference for Steroid-Free and Safer Therapies
Growing safety concerns strongly drive the steroid-free nasal sprays market. Patients increasingly avoid long-term steroid exposure due to side effects. These include nasal irritation, dryness, and systemic absorption risks. Physicians also prefer safer options for chronic use. Pediatric and geriatric populations show higher sensitivity to steroids. This increases demand for non-steroidal alternatives. Antihistamine and cromolyn sodium sprays benefit most from this shift. Over-the-counter availability further supports adoption. Consumers value products suitable for daily and preventive use. Clear labeling and safety claims influence purchase decisions. This preference strengthens demand across developed and emerging markets.
- For instance, azelastine nasal spray provides symptom relief of allergic rhinitis with onset within one hour and duration up to 12 hours when used intranasally.

Key Challenges
Limited Efficacy in Severe and Chronic Conditions
Efficacy limitations present a key challenge. Steroid-free sprays may underperform in severe inflammation. Physicians still prefer steroids for advanced cases. This restricts use in certain patient groups. Symptom relief duration may remain shorter. Some products require frequent dosing. Patient expectations may not always match outcomes. This can affect satisfaction and brand loyalty. Education remains essential to manage use cases. These limitations constrain full therapeutic replacement.
